This is a Category A project according to IFC’s Procedure for Environment and Social Review of projects. The environmental, health, safety and social (EHSS) issues associated with this project that were identified in the original project review included:
- land acquisition and compensation;
- fisheries and riverine hydrology;
- loss of forests and common property resources such as grazing land;
- environmental and social impacts of the influx of a temporary construction work-force;
- environmental management of construction activities;
- worker health and safety during project construction and operations phases;
- employment of child labor during construction;
- dam safety;
- international waterways and the cumulative impacts of river basin development.
IFC’s ongoing review and supervision of the existing investment in ADHPL (since construction commenced in 2005) has shown the EHSS performance of the project is, for the most part, sound, especially given the size and complexity of the construction, coupled with the challenges of the site’s terrain and geology. IFC’s Independent Engineer also reports quarterly on environmental, social and health and safety aspects of the project.
